The Dryden Regional Health Centre is about 75% of the way to reaching its $170,000 goal to purchase a new Ultrasound Machine.
The Hospital has provided an update on the heels of a $10,000 donation from Trans Canada Pipelines.
Physician Recruiter Chuck Schmitt notes they also received another $10,000 from an annoymous donor.
Over 2,500 Ultrasound exams are performed annually at the Health Centre.
The Province doesn’t provide funding for equipment expenses.
A fundraising campaign was launched last October
